#32c90f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#32c90f is composed of 19.6% red, 78.8%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.5%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 108.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#32c90f color hex could be obtained by blending #64ff1e with #009300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

● #32c90f color description : Strong lime green.
The hexadecimal color #32c90f has RGB values of R:50, G:201,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 3328271.
